Ministry Of Health Issues Zika Advisory To Pregnant Women

September 19, 2016

The Ministry of Health today adviced pregnant women to be vigilant in traveling to countries which are prone to the Zika Virus.

Active transmission of Zika have been reported in the Americas (with the exception of Canada, Chile, Uruguay), several countries in Oceania and Cape Verde in Africa.

Singapore has also reported cases of Zika transmission.

Zika is spread mostly by the bite of an infected Aedes species mosquito (Ae. aegypti and Ae. albopictus). These mosquitoes are aggressive daytime biters. They can also bite at night.

Zika can be passed from a pregnant woman to her fetus. Infection during pregnancy can cause certain birth defects.

There is no vaccine or medicine for Zika.
